William King Beard was born in Arcadia, FL, on May 18th, 1950. He attended the University of Florida, where he earned his Bachelor's degree in English Literature. He went on to teach English Literature at Sebring High School. He later taught in an educational program at the Wauchula Correctional Institution, where he helped hundreds of inmates earn their GEDs. William was also a devoted Christian who loved to study scripture, and he praised God for all things. Most importantly, he was a father who loved his children unconditionally, and they are blessed to have learned so much from him. His children will always remember his quick wit and incredible sense of humor, and they will keep him in their hearts forever. William has moved on from this world to be with his son, Dylan Kai Beard, his father, William Weldon Beard, and his mother, Doris Beard, in Heaven. Remaining to keep his memory are his sister, Karen Beard-Wilson, his daughters Laleña Beard, Lauren Robinson, Emily Beard, and Sophia Holmes, and his sons Paul Beard and Luke Beard. He also leaves behind his grandchildren, Will Robinson, Kathryn Robinson, Willow Quikbeard, Mason Holmes, and Noah Holmes.
A graveside service will be held at Oak Ridge Cemetery on Wednesday, June 17, 2026, at 4:00 pm.
